Configurer le suivi des messages

S’applique à : Exchange Server 2013

Le suivi des messages enregistre l’activité de transport SMTP de tous les messages transférés vers et depuis le service de transport ou les boîtes aux lettres sur un serveur de boîtes aux lettres Microsoft Exchange Server 2013. Les journaux de suivi des messages sont utiles pour les investigations sur les messages ainsi que pour l'analyse, les rapports et le dépannage du flux de messagerie.

Ce qu'il faut savoir avant de commencer

  • Durée d'exécution estimée : 15 minutes

  • Des autorisations doivent vous être attribuées avant de pouvoir exécuter cette procédure. Pour connaître les autorisations dont vous avez besoin, consultez les entrées « Service de transport » dans la rubrique Autorisations de flux de courrier ou l’entrée « Configuration du serveur de boîte aux lettres » dans la rubrique Autorisations des destinataires .

  • Vous pouvez utiliser le Centre d’administration Exchange (EAC) pour activer ou désactiver le suivi des messages, ou définir le chemin du journal de suivi des messages. Pour toutes les autres options de suivi des messages, vous devez utiliser Exchange Management Shell.

  • Sur un serveur de boîtes aux lettres Exchange 2013, vous pouvez utiliser l’applet de commande Set-TransportService ou Set-MailboxServer pour configurer les options de suivi des messages. Les procédures de cette rubrique utilisent l’applet de commande Set-TransportService .

  • Pour des informations sur les raccourcis clavier applicables aux procédures de cette rubrique, voir Raccourcis clavier dans Exchange 2013Raccourcis clavier dans le Centre d'administration Exchange.

Conseil

Vous rencontrez des difficultés ? Demandez de l’aide en participant aux forums Exchange. Visitez les forums de Exchange Server.

Utiliser le Centre d'administration Exchange pour configurer le suivi des messages sur des serveurs de boîtes aux lettres

  1. Dans le Centre d’administration Exchange, rendez-vous sur Serveurs > Serveurs.

  2. Sélectionnez le serveur de boîtes aux lettres que vous souhaitez configurer, puis cliquez sur l’icône Modifierla modification..

  3. Dans la page des propriétés du serveur, cliquez sur Journaux de transport.

  4. Dans la section Journal de suivi des messages, modifiez l’une des options suivantes :

    • Activer le journal de suivi des messages : pour désactiver le suivi des messages sur le serveur, désactivez la case à cocher. Pour activer cette fonctionnalité sur le serveur, cochez la case.

    • Chemin d’accès au journal de suivi des messages : la valeur que vous spécifiez doit être sur le serveur Exchange local. Si le dossier n’existe pas, il est créé pour vous lorsque vous cliquez sur Enregistrer.

  5. Cliquez sur Enregistrer.

Utiliser l’interpréteur de commandes pour configurer le suivi des messages

Pour configurer le suivi des messages, exécutez la commande suivante :

Set-TransportService <ServerIdentity> -MessageTrackingLogEnabled <$true | $false> -MessageTrackingLogMaxAge <dd.hh:mm:ss> -MessageTrackingLogMaxDirectorySize <Size> -MessageTrackingLogMaxFileSize <Size> -MessageTrackingLogPath <LocalFilePath> -MessageTrackingLogSubjectLoggingEnabled <$true|$false>

Cet exemple définit les paramètres de journal de suivi des messages suivants sur le serveur de boîtes aux lettres nommé Mailbox01 :

  • Définit la localisation des fichiers journaux de suivi des messages sur D:\Message Tracking Log. Notez bien que si le dossier n'existe pas, il sera créé pour vous.
  • Définit la taille maximale d'un fichier journal de suivi des messages à 20 Mo.
  • Définit la taille maximale du répertoire des journaux de suivi des messages à 1,5 Go.
  • Définit l'âge maximal d'un fichier journal de suivi des messages à 45 jours.
Set-TransportService Mailbox01 -MessageTrackingLogPath "D:\Hub Message Tracking Log" -MessageTrackingLogMaxFileSize 20MB -MessageTrackingLogMaxDirectorySize 1.5GB -MessageTrackingLogMaxAge 45.00:00:00

Remarque

  • La définition du paramètre MessageTrackingLogPath sur la valeur $nulldésactive efficacement le suivi des messages. Toutefois, si la valeur du paramètre MessageTrackingLogEnabled est $true, des erreurs de journal des événements sont générées.

  • La définition du paramètre MessageTrackingLogMaxAge sur la valeur 00:00:00 empêche la suppression automatique des fichiers journaux de suivi des messages en raison de leur âge.

  • Sur les serveurs de boîtes aux lettres Exchange 2013, la taille maximale du répertoire du journal de suivi des messages est trois fois la valeur du paramètre MessageTrackingLogMaxDirectorySize . Si les fichiers journaux de suivi des messages générés par les quatre différents services portent des préfixes de nom différents, la quantité de données et la fréquence d'écriture de ces dernières dans les fichiers journaux MSGTRKMA sont négligeables en comparaison des fichiers journaux portant les trois autres préfixes. Pour plus d'informations, consultez la section « Structure des fichiers journaux de suivi des messages » dans la rubrique Suivi des messages.

Cet exemple désactive la journalisation de l’objet des messages dans le journal de suivi des messages sur le serveur de boîtes aux lettres nommé Mailbox01 :

Set-TransportService Mailbox01 -MessageTrackingLogSubjectLoggingEnabled $false

Cet exemple désactive le suivi des messages sur le serveur de boîtes aux lettres intitulé Mailbox01 :

Set-TransportService Mailbox01 -MessageTrackingLogEnabled $false

Comment savoir si cela a fonctionné ?

Pour vérifier que vous avez correctement configuré le suivi des messages, procédez comme suit :

  1. Dans l'environnement de ligne de commande Exchange Management Shell, exécutez la commande suivante :

    Get-TransportService <ServerIdentity> | Format-List MessageTrackingLog*
    
  2. Vérifiez que les valeurs affichées sont celles que vous avez configurées.